- The distance between Hassi Messaoud, Algeria and Danville, Il, Usa is approximately 8,131 km or 5,053 mi.
- To reach Hassi Messaoud in this distance one would set out from Danville, Il bearing 62.5°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Hassi Messaoud bearing 127° or SE .
- Hassi Messaoud has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Danville, Il has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- Hassi Messaoud is in or near the subtropical desert biome whereas Danville, Il is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average temperature is 11.2 °C (20.2°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 5 °C (9°F) less in Hassi Messaoud.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 976.8 mm (38.5 in) less which is equivalent to 976.8 l/m² (23.97 US gal/ft²) or 9,768,000 l/ha (1,044,264 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 8.3° higher in Hassi Messaoud than in Danville, Il.
